Duration of spermatogenesis and sperm transit time through the epididymis in the Piau boar

Tissue and Cell, 1998
The Piau boar is a rustic breed of economical importance in Brazil. The duration of spermatogenesis and sperm transit through the epididymis in Piau boars was estimated using intratesticular injections of tritiated thymidine. Animals were sacrificed 1 h, 7 days, 14 days, 21 days, 34 days, and 36 days after injections.
